Dane Sweeny: The Underdog that Stole Hearts at the Australian Open

Australian Open - Dane Sweeny - Francisco Cerundolo - Lleyton Hewitt - Tennis

Local hero Dane Sweeny may have lost a thriller at the Australian Open, but he certainly won over the crowd with his tenacity and tennis skills. Making his Grand Slam main-draw debut alongside Adam Walton, Sweeny showcased his talent in a spectacular duel that almost secured him an unlikely victory. The unheralded Sunshine Coast qualifier proved to be a fan favorite on day one at the tournament, setting the stage for an exciting run. As the competition heated up, Sweeny faced tough challenges and even forced a fifth set against Argentinian player Francisco Cerundolo.

Despite falling short in his debut match, Dane Sweeny's resilient performance against Cerundolo marked the beginning of a promising career. The Australian Open 2024 saw Sweeny captivate audiences with his fighting spirit, earning comparisons to legendary player Lleyton Hewitt. His uncanny resemblance to Hewitt added to the intrigue, further endearing him to the Australian Open crowd. As the tournament unfolded, Sweeny's journey became a focal point, with fans eagerly anticipating his future matches.

In the clash between Sweeny and Cerundolo, the Argentine player emerged victorious with a 3-6, 6-3, 6-4, 2-6, 6-2 score. Despite the outcome, Sweeny's performance left a lasting impression, setting the stage for his continued success in the tennis world. As the Australian Open progressed, Sweeny's near-upset and undeniable charm solidified his position as a rising star to watch. With his debut marked by resilience and talent, Dane Sweeny's impact on the tournament was truly unforgettable.
